Criando um PBX 3CX baseado em nuvem em qualquer hospedagem compatível com Openstack

Muitas vezes, você precisa instalar um PBX 3CX na nuvem, mas o provedor de nuvem escolhido não está incluído na lista dos compatíveis com o 3CX (por exemplo, Mail.ru Cloud Solutions). Nada para se preocupar! Não é difícil fazer isso, você só precisa descobrir se o provedor suporta a infraestrutura Openstack. A 3CX, entre outras empresas, patrocina o desenvolvimento do Openstack e suporta a API Openstack e a interface padrão Horizon para monitoramento e gerenciamento.

Portanto, para instalar o 3CX, você precisará de:

  • Provedor de nuvem compatível com a API Openstack com a conta ativada
  • Credenciais de acesso à API para o serviço PBX Express, incluindo o URL da API Openstack

Considere instalar uma nuvem 3CX, usando o exemplo do provedor Dreamhost.

Criando uma conta de hospedagem OpenStack


1. Acesse https://www.dreamhost.com/ e acesse a seção Hosting & Servers> Cloud. Na página exibida, clique em Introdução ao DreamCompute.



2. Preencha suas credenciais. A API de computação requer uma senha separada, usada pelo serviço PBX Express para trocar dados com a plataforma Dreamst Openstack. Qualquer provedor Openstack solicitará as mesmas informações.



3. Após o registro, você receberá um e-mail com as informações necessárias para verificar e ativar sua conta. Normalmente, as operadoras solicitam uma verificação das informações do seu passaporte ou cartão de crédito.

Configuração da conta do OpenStack para 3CX PBX Express


4. Após verificar a conta, vá para o painel de controle, vá para a seção Serviços em nuvem e clique em DreamCompute.



5. Aqui você verá o ID e o nome do usuário (ID e Nome do usuário). Corrija-os - você precisará desses dados ao instalar o 3CX através do serviço PBX Express. Em seguida, clique em Exibir painel.



6. No painel de controle, acesse a página Acesso e segurança> API de acesso. Aqui, corrija o URL na linha de identidade - nesse URL, o PBX Express acessa a nuvem do Dreamhost OpenStack.


7. Na seção Acesso e segurança, vá para a guia Pares de chaves e clique em Criar par de chaves.



8. Na janela exibida, digite o nome do par de chaves e clique em Criar Par de Chaves. As chaves serão criadas e baixadas para o seu disco.



Instale o 3CX Cloud através do PBX Express


9. Agora você está pronto para instalar o PBX baseado em nuvem 3CX através do serviço 3CX PBX Express . Em um estágio do Assistente de PBX Express, uma solicitação para os parâmetros da sua hospedagem Openstack será exibida. Usando esses parâmetros, o PBX Express cria automaticamente um servidor VPS com o 3CX instalado. Os seguintes parâmetros são especificados para o Dreamhost:

  • Selecione Hospedagem - provedor de nuvem VPS (compatível com OpenStack API v2)
  • URL da API do provedor de nuvem - URL da etapa 6
  • Nome de usuário - nome de usuário da etapa 5
  • Senha - ID do inquilino da etapa 5



10. Na próxima página, se você não souber o que indicar, basta clicar em Avançar. Se você for guiado por esses parâmetros, poderá especificar o local do servidor, a capacidade do servidor e o par de chaves SSH usadas. A imagem a ser instalada deve ser apenas Debian-9.


Em seguida, clique em Avançar e insira seus dados pessoais. Após um curto período de tempo, seu PBX baseado em nuvem estará pronto - você receberá uma notificação apropriada por e-mail. Salve - ele contém informações importantes.

Agora você pode continuar a configurar o PBX - conectar usuários , linhas externas , etc.

Source: https://habr.com/ru/post/pt461575/


All Articles